Trump Advises Japan's Sanae Takaichi Not to Provoke China Over Taiwan

TEMPO.CO, Jakarta - President of the United States Donald Trump advised Japan's Prime Minister Sanae Takaichi not to provoke China over Taiwan's sovereignty, as reported by The Wall Street Journal as cited by CNA on Wednesday, amid escalating tensions between Tokyo and Beijing.

This comes after Takaichi's statement in early November in front of parliament, implying that a Chinese attack on the self-governing democratic island could trigger a response involving the Japanese defense forces.

In a phone call with Trump on Monday, China's President Xi Jinping emphasized the always-sensitive issue, stating that the return of the island is an "integral part of the post-war international order," according to the Chinese Foreign Ministry.

Shortly after, "Trump set up a call with Takaichi and advised her not to provoke Beijing on the question of the island's sovereignty," as reported by WSJ, citing Japanese officials and an American briefed on the call.

According to the newspaper, Trump's advice was subtle, and he did not press Takaichi to retract her statements. A spokesperson for Takaichi's office declined to comment when contacted by the media.

In its report on the phone call, the Japanese Prime Minister said that she and Trump discussed their conversation with Xi, as well as the relationship between the two allies.

"President Trump said we are very close friends, and he offered that I should feel free to call him anytime," she said.

Previously, Trump praised Takaichi for her firm stance on defense, and during his recent visit to Japan, he highlighted the strength of the U.S.-Japan alliance.

However, Takaichi's stance has angered Chinese President Xi Jinping, something the U.S. newspaper described as a "bad time for Trump, who is trying to build a relationship with the Chinese leader."

According to someone briefed on the call, Trump advised Takaichi to soften her statements regarding Taiwan.

The unnamed source added that Trump had been briefed on the domestic political constraints Takaichi faces. He realized that it was unlikely the first female Japanese prime minister would fully retract the statement that angered Beijing.

The article said that Japanese officials found Trump's message worrying, as it indicated that Trump does not want the Taiwan issue to disrupt the easing of tensions he reached with Xi last month. This includes a promise to buy more agricultural products from American farmers affected by the trade war.

Japan and China have been embroiled in diplomatic disputes since Beijing strongly condemned Takaichi's response to a parliamentary question on November 7, in which she said that a military attack on Taiwan could create a "situation threatening the survival" of Japan.

Her statement was interpreted as a signal that her government could allow the Self-Defense Forces to support the United States if China imposed a maritime blockade on Taiwan or used other forms of pressure.

China was furious over Takaichi's comments. Beijing summoned Tokyo's ambassador and urged its citizens not to travel to Japan.

At least two Japanese film releases have been postponed in China, according to Chinese state media.

The Communist Party-led Chinese government regards Taiwan as a rebellious province that must be reunited with the mainland, if necessary, by military force.

Beijing insists that the Taiwan issue - which has been separately governed since the 1949 civil war - is purely an "internal affair."
